CSS可以用于創建3D效果,可以通過設置盒模型、背景和陰影等屬性來創建復雜的3D圖形。在這篇文章中,我們將介紹如何使用CSS創建一個3D盒子。
首先,我們需要了解3D盒子的概念。3D盒子是指一個具有三個維度的盒子,即高度、寬度和深度。在傳統的2D世界中,盒子只有高度和寬度,但是在3D世界中,盒子具有深度。因此,3D盒子可以被視為一個具有深度的二維盒子。
接下來,我們將使用CSS創建一個簡單的3D盒子。我們需要使用一個HTML元素作為盒子的父元素,并設置其盒模型為“all”,以使其具有所有維度。然后,我們將為盒子添加一個背景,可以使用CSS的“background”屬性來設置背景圖像。最后,我們可以使用CSS的“box-shadow”屬性來創建陰影,以使盒子更加逼真。
下面是一個簡單的示例代碼,用于演示如何使用CSS創建一個3D盒子:
```html
<div style="box-shadow: 0px 0px 10px rgba(0,0,0,0.3); height: 100px; width: 100px; background-color: blue;">
這是一個3D盒子。
</div>
在這個例子中,我們使用“box-shadow”屬性來創建三個陰影,以使盒子更加逼真。陰影的強度值可以根據需要進行調整。
當然,這只是一個簡單的示例。我們可以使用更多的CSS屬性來控制3D盒子的外觀和行為,例如顏色、透明度、形狀等等。我們可以使用CSS的“transform”屬性來旋轉和縮放盒子,也可以使用“transform-origin”屬性來控制中心位置。
通過使用CSS,我們可以創建出各種復雜的3D圖形,從而在Web應用程序和游戲中發揮重要作用。